Abstract

Serum thyroxine (T4) and thyrotropin TSH) were determined in 5 malnourished children and 5 well nourished controls matched for age and sex. The age range of both groups of subjects was nine months to three years. The serum level of T4 were 80.00 +2.31 ng/ml and 45.40+ 14.03 ng/m1 for control and malnourished subjects respectively.
